Kryuel, designated as PGD-006, holds a distinct place in the 2003 Yu-Gi-Oh! Pharaonic Guardian set for collectors of the Trading Card Game. This Common rarity card introduces the Fiend archetype, characterized by its DARK attribute and Level 4 status, which serves as a foundational piece for various monster strategies. The card’s classification as an Effect Monster highlights its gameplay utility, offering players a tactical option to manipulate the field without the constraints of higher-level summoning requirements. Card Text
Abilities, attacks, oracle text, and flavor text printed on the card.
When this card is sent to the Graveyard as a result of battle, toss a coin and call it. If you call it right, destroy 1 monster on your opponent's side of the field.
